In the world of healthcare, where emotions range from joy to worry, and days can be long and challenging, humour often becomes an unexpected yet essential source of relief. A Dose of Laughter: Hearty Medical Jokes to Boost Your Spirits is a delightful collection of jokes, anecdotes, and witty observations from the medical world, designed to bring smiles and laughter to patients, doctors, nurses, and anyone who has ever stepped foot into a doctor's office.
This book explores the lighter side of medicine, blending humour with relatable experiences that everyone has encountered in the often nerve-wracking, but also hilarious, settings of hospitals and clinics. With its wide variety of jokes, the collection touches on topics ranging from doctor-patient misunderstandings to the everyday absurdities of medical life. Whether it's the confusion over prescriptions, the ridiculous self-diagnoses we all make after a little too much time online, or the funny quirks of healthcare professionals themselves, this book offers something for everyone.
For patients, A Dose of Laughter provides a humorous perspective on the often intimidating experience of navigating healthcare. The jokes remind us that while medical issues may be serious, there is always room for a little levity. Through clever one-liners, comical doctor-patient conversations, and funny situations that reflect the reality of everyday healthcare, this book brings light to the challenges of dealing with health concerns.
For medical professionals, this collection offers a way to step back from the intense pressures of their work and enjoy a laugh at the shared quirks of their profession. With stories about forgetful doctors, overly enthusiastic medical students, and patients with wildly imaginative self-diagnoses, healthcare workers will find plenty to relate to. The book highlights the human side of medicine, reminding those in the field that laughter is an important tool for staying connected and compassionate amid the demands of their careers.
The humour in A Dose of Laughter is both light-hearted and insightful, pointing out the ironies and amusing contradictions in medical experiences while also celebrating the role of humour in healing. It's a reminder that laughter not only uplifts spirits but also plays a vital role in relieving stress, breaking down barriers between patients and healthcare providers, and ultimately aiding in the recovery process.
With lots of jokes and short humorous stories, this book is perfect for passing time in waiting rooms, bringing a smile to a friend or family member dealing with medical challenges, or simply as a source of comfort and joy when a pick-me-up is needed. Whether you're a healthcare worker looking to unwind or a patient needing a little laughter to brighten your day, A Dose of Laughter offers an amusing escape into the lighter side of the medical world.
